Fleroxacin, 400 mg once daily, and norfloxacin, 400 mg twice daily, both administered orally, were compared for the treatment of serious urinary tract infections (UTIs). In total, 301 patients from multiple centers who had serious UTIs were randomized to receive fleroxacin or norfloxacin in a

Eighty-three patients with serious urinary tract infections were treated with oral ciprofloxacin. Of these patients, 79 were hospitalized, and 41 had known structural or neurologic abnormalities of the urinary tract. OBJECTIVE To determine if a single perioperative dose of dexamethasone increases the risk of infection after urogynecologic surgery. The study was undertaken to compare the safety and efficacy of twice-daily ciprofloxacin for 3 days with standard 7 day therapy with either co-trimoxazole or nitrofurantoin in the treatment of women with acute, uncomplicated urinary tract infections (UTI).
